Interior problems like ruptured pipelines and overflows can result in emergency situation flooding. Maintain on reviewing to locate out what you can when dealing with emergency situation flooding.

1. Turn Off Key Water Valve

Pipes can break due to cold temperatures, high pressure, blockage, water heater problems, and other aspects. No matter the reason, you have to act swiftly to ensure porous home materials, appliances, as well as home furnishings do not soak up the water, causing damages. Turn off the major valve prior to you do any type of cleansing to make sure water stops gathering. Killing the water resource is simple, and also it is something you can do yourself. When it comes to the burst pipe, ask for emergency situation pipes services to repair it as soon as possible.

2. Shut down the Circuit Breaker

With a large flood, you need to make certain the power is out. Water is a conductor, as well as if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can cause injuries or casualties. Shut off the circuit breaker to avoid electrocution. If you can not do it, make a fast contact us to the power company to shut the primary line. Maintain the power off until excess water is gone.

3. Move Essential Wet Times

When it involves conserving your furnishings as well as home appliances, time is of the essence. For this reason, you have to move whatever whet personal belongings you can from the affected area to a completely dry location. This discourages further damage since the longer they soak in water, the extra extensive the problem.

4. Document the Level of Damages

Remember of all the damage brought upon by the burst pipeline. You can document notes, take pictures, as well as collect videos. This is a terrific way to supply evidence to gather cases on your house insurance coverage. With paperwork, you can also get a clear image of the extent of the damages.

5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P

You must get rid of excess water as soon as possible. Ought to there be a big amount of standing water, you may require a water pump for extraction. You can rent this tools if you do not have one. If it's late in the evening, the convention container method additionally works. Usage several jugs as well as manual work to take it out. When marginal water is left, you can take in the rest with old t shirts or towels. You may also need to eliminate broken products like carpetings and also carpets.

6. Dry the Area

You can likewise establish up electrical followers and put them in the best setting. A dehumidifier also works in taking out wetness to stop mold and mold and mildews.

7. Deal with Experts

When you experience comprehensive water damages as a result of emergency situation flooding from a ruptured pipe, you can work with a reconstruction professional to restore and refurbish your residence. Most of all, don't neglect to call a credible plumber to fix the ruptured pipe and examine the remainder of your piping system. Otherwise, all your clean-up will certainly be provided pointless.

Making It Through the Imperfect Storm: Tips for Emergency Preparations



If you live in a storm-prone area, you should be made use of by now on what to do, where to go and also what to need to be prepared for bad weather. Nonetheless, if you're not used to obtaining pummeled by high winds and also hard rainfall, you probably do not have an concept exactly how best to deal with a storm situation.

For beginners, storms do not just come without a warning. Weather stations keep track of the atmosphere day in and day out. If a storm is feasible, they will certainly provide two kinds of warnings: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a possible storm in your area. You most likely will be experiencing a dark, gloomy sky, an abnormally gusty day and also some rain. The tornado may or may not come, however this is the time to maintain tuned to your neighborhood radio for information as well as updates.

Storm warning-- is provided when a tornado is headed toward your area. Try to stay indoors as long as feasible. Or if locals are recommended to leave to a much safer place, go as early as you can. Do not wait up until the eleventh hour to leave your residence. By that time, the streets could be swamped and also website traffic is bad. You don't intend to be caught in your car in bad climate.

Blizzard-- typically takes place in wintertime and implies heavy snow, strong winds and wind cool. When a warning is released, prevent taking a trip as much as possible as well as remain indoors. There is no usage subjecting on your own outdoors where you could get caught in web traffic or in locations where you will certainly be challenging to get to or even worse, discover.

For all our innovation, nobody can quit a tornado from coming. The only method to endure it is to be prepared to deal with the emergency situation. Things don't always spoil throughout tornados, but weather is unpredictable and anything can occur. To assist you plan for a storm emergency, right here are a few suggestions:

Spruce up.
Use enough clothing to maintain on your own warm. Warm might not be offered in your house so get additional coats and coverings to keep your body temperature completely.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and boots prepared.

Have food prepared.
Emergency stipulations are a have to during tornado emergencies. If the tornado gets also poor and the roads are flooded, you will certainly have a difficulty going out to the grocery stores.

Keep containers of water useful. Tidy water might be difficult ahead by during really negative conditions as well as the most awful thing you can do is deal with dehydration because you were not prepared. Keep a supply of a minimum of one gallon for each individual each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Load the bathtub.
You'll need extra water for cleaning as well as flushing the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ump won't operate, so best load your bath tub, water containers and also jugs with water. If you have children in your home, take safety measures by covering deep containers and maintaining children far from the washroom unless essential.

Emergency situation set
Have a medical or first kit all set as well as make sure it's freshly-stocked. It needs to include disinfectants, gauzes, cotton spheres, Q-tips, medicated plasters and needed medications. It's additionally a excellent idea to have one more package in your vehicle.

If anyone in your family members is under unique medication, ensure you have sufficient supplies to last until after the tornado is over and also medication shops are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power failures throughout storm emergencies. You won't have any electrical power, so stock on candle lights, flashlights and also emergency situation lights. Have added fresh batteries and suits in case you run out.

If you can't turn on the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your area. Media will certainly keep track of the tornado and will certainly keep you updated.

You might need warm water during the period when power is not yet offered, so keep a little container of gas about just in case. Your outside barbecue grill will do well.

Get an alternate sanctuary.
Make certain you have sufficient gas in your tank in situation you need to get out of the house and also step someplace. Maintain to a higher ground where you have far better opportunities of being safe and dry.
